Now I don't want to get anyone mad. But I really don't understand this. There are some scriptures that make God's stand on abortion a little less than clear at least to me. Numbers 31:17 (Moses) “Now therefore kill every male among the little ones, and kill every women that hath known man by lying with him.” In other words: women that might be pregnant, which clearly is abortion for the fetus.

If God is strictly against all abortion, why does He appear to order at least the possibility of it here (not to mention the other barbarity) or was this just Moses over-doing it?

Morally wrong? What exactly does that mean. Can you specifically define everything that is and isn't morally wrong and say with 100% certainty that that applies to every person, everywhere for all time?

Do I think rape is morally wrong? You won't like my answer. No, I don't. I think it's socially wrong, and because of that it becomes morally wrong for a majority of people. Morals are something personal, social values are more broadly defined. Personally, for myself, rape is morally wrong, it's horrid and it's something that should be punished to the full extent of modern laws. However if you look at someone who is about to commit rape and ask them if what they are doing is morally wrong, they'll either laugh, kill you or rape you as well.

Morals are subjective, whether we like it or not. The Bible is not in anyway specific in it's condemnation of abortion. In fact as has already been stated, according to a strict literal interpretation of the Bible, God delights in killing unborn children.

For me personally, abortion is wrong. But, and this is a huge but, I will not tell someone else that they have to live by my interpretation of morality. I certainly wouldn't like it if someone came to me and said that killing anything at all was immoral, because when a mosquito bites me, I'm killing it, regardless of anyone else's morality.
